Take a Tour of Chelsea-Based Art Group's Eclectic Holiday Mixer Oresti /NITESIDE
Amanda McDonald Crowley, executive director of non-profit Eyebeam, walks us through the group's unconventional holiday mixer over the weekend at the art and technology center's Chelsea digs. The merry mixer -- thrown by trendy event group Mean Red -- was host to interactive art, DIY gifts, a book launch and even several seven-deadly-sins-themed snowglobes.
